

Make the move from guiding divers to teaching them with the PADI Instructor Development Course on Koh Lanta, the Andaman-coast base for Thailand's most dramatic big-fish diving. The sheltered lagoon and caverns of Koh Haa give instructor candidates a calm, forgiving classroom to rehearse teaching presentations, while the deep pinnacles of Hin Daeng and Hin Muang sharpen the dive leadership you will model for students. You finish the IDC ready to sit the Instructor Examination and certify divers of your own.
The PADI IDC trains and assesses you against PADI standards, then prepares you for the Instructor Examination, which is run independently by a PADI Examiner. Pass the IE and you become a teaching member of PADI with a renewable Open Water Scuba Instructor rating, access to professional insurance and the worldwide PADI jobs network.
Teaching workshops use the calm Koh Haa lagoon and the shallower coral walls of Koh Bida, while dive-leadership practice ranges out to the deep pinnacles of Hin Daeng and Hin Muang. The Andaman season runs roughly November to April, with warm 27-30°C water and the settled conditions that make Koh Lanta a solid base for instructor training.
